CLEVELAND, OH (WOIO) –

Much of northeast Ohio is under a winter storm warning effect. Travel overnight could be hazardous. Cleveland has released its snow plan for the upcoming snow storm.

•    The City has 60 available trucks and more than 29,000 tons of salt.

•    The first shift currently has 38 trucks ready to deploy to city streets, all of which are loaded with salt.

•    Two trucks are pre-treating hills, and will then move to bridges.

•    The second shift (3:00 p.m.) will have 24 trucks on the road, but will add additional trucks as needed.

•    At 11:00 p.m. the City will have 44 trucks deployed on city streets throughout the evening.
